Days after Taiwan approved a major weapons purchase from Washington, Defense Minister Wellington Koo says the government has not received any information suggesting delays to a second arms package from the United States.

00:00Defense Minister Wellington Kou says the country has no information on reported delays to a U.S. arms package.
00:19On Friday, Reuters reported that the U.S. government was delaying a major weapons agreement with Taiwan
00:25until after U.S. President Donald Trump's visit to Beijing.
00:28But with Trump now seeking to delay that trip, the timing of the arms package is unclear.
00:33The war in Iran has led to concerns that the U.S. may not be able to fulfill its defense
00:37commitments in the Asia-Pacific
00:39as it moves forces to the Middle East.
